Capgemini

Data Engineer (AWS Glue, Airflow, Lambda, Postgres) (contract)

⭐ - Featured Role | Apply direct with Data Freelance Hub
This role is for a Data Engineer (contract) with a pay rate of $39.86-$62.29/hour. Key skills include AWS Glue, Airflow, Lambda, Postgres, and Python. Requires 6+ years of experience in Data Engineering and proficiency in SQL for complex transformations.
🌎 - Country
United States
πŸ’± - Currency
$ USD
-
πŸ’° - Day rate
312
-
πŸ—“οΈ - Date
May 28, 2026
πŸ•’ - Duration
Unknown
-
🏝️ - Location
Unknown
-
πŸ“„ - Contract
Unknown
-
πŸ”’ - Security
Unknown
-
πŸ“ - Location detailed
Fort Mill, SC
-
🧠 - Skills detailed
#Lambda (AWS Lambda) #Metadata #Data Warehouse #Triggers #Consulting #Data Processing #Automation #Logging #Data Engineering #GitHub #Data Pipeline #Scala #PySpark #Python #SNS (Simple Notification Service) #BI (Business Intelligence) #Monitoring #AWS Lambda #Data Ingestion #Apache Airflow #SQL (Structured Query Language) #AWS (Amazon Web Services) #IAM (Identity and Access Management) #Snowflake #S3 (Amazon Simple Storage Service) #Data Modeling #AWS IAM (AWS Identity and Access Management) #Data Architecture #"ETL (Extract #Transform #Load)" #SQL Queries #Security #Deployment #Spark (Apache Spark) #Data Security #Terraform #Cloud #Batch #Airflow #Data Lake #Data Catalog #AWS Glue
Role description
Data Engineer (AWS Glue, Airflow, Lambda, Postgres) Role Overview We are seeking a skilled Data Engineer with strong hands-on experience in AWS-native data services, particularly Glue, Lambda, EventBridge, and workflow orchestration using Airflow. The role focuses on building scalable, event-driven data pipelines and supporting data processing and analytics on AWS and Postgres platforms. Key Responsibilities β€’ Design and develop scalable data pipelines using AWS Glue, Lambda, and EventBridge for event-driven and batch processing. β€’ Build and maintain AWS Glue ETL jobs (PySpark/Python) for data ingestion, transformation, and curation across data lake layers. β€’ Develop and manage Airflow DAGs (MWAA or self-managed) to orchestrate data workflows, triggers, and dependencies across AWS services. β€’ Implement event-driven architectures using AWS Lambda and EventBridge for near real-time data processing. β€’ Write, optimize, and maintain complex SQL queries in Postgres for data validation, transformation, and reporting. β€’ Manage metadata and schema definitions using AWS Glue Data Catalog, ensuring proper governance and discoverability. β€’ Build and support robust data ingestion frameworks for batch and near real-time data pipelines. β€’ Monitor and troubleshoot pipeline performance using AWS monitoring tools (CloudWatch, logs, alerts). β€’ Collaborate with downstream teams (BI, analytics, and Snowflake if applicable) to ensure reliable data consumption. β€’ Contribute to system reliability, scalability, and performance optimization of the data platform. Required Skills & Qualifications β€’ 6+ years of experience in Data Engineering or a related field. β€’ Strong hands-on expertise in AWS Glue, Lambda, EventBridge, and S3. β€’ Experience building and orchestrating workflows using Apache Airflow (MWAA preferred). β€’ Strong proficiency in SQL (Postgres preferred) for complex transformations and performance tuning. β€’ Experience with Python / PySpark for ETL development. β€’ Solid understanding of event-driven data architecture and pipeline design. β€’ Familiarity with AWS IAM, CloudWatch, and logging/monitoring frameworks. β€’ Experience with CI/CD pipelines (e.g., GitHub Actions) for deployment automation. Preferred Skills β€’ Experience with Terraform or infrastructure-as-code tools. β€’ Knowledge of data lake formats (Parquet, Iceberg, Delta). β€’ Understanding of data modeling, partitioning, and schema evolution. β€’ Familiarity with AWS services such as Lake Formation, SNS, and CloudTrail. β€’ Exposure to Snowflake or other data warehouse platforms is a plus. The pay range that the employer in good faith reasonably expects to pay for this position is $39.86/hour - $62.29/hour. Our offered benefits include medical, dental, vision and retirement benefits. Applications will be accepted on an ongoing basis. Tundra Technical Solutions is among North America’s leading providers of Staffing and Consulting Services. Our success and our clients’ success are built on a foundation of service excellence. We are an equal opportunity employer, and we do not discriminate on the basis of race, religion, color, national origin, sex, sexual orientation, age, veteran status, disability, genetic information, or other applicable legally protected characteristic. Qualified applicants with arrest or conviction records will be considered for employment in accordance with applicable law, including the Los Angeles County Fair Chance Ordinance for Employers and the California Fair Chance Act. Unincorporated LA County workers: we reasonably believe that criminal history may have a direct, adverse and negative relationship with the following job duties, potentially resulting in the withdrawal of a conditional offer of employment: client provided property, including hardware (both of which may include data) entrusted to you from theft, loss or damage; return all portable client computer hardware in your possession (including the data contained therein) upon completion of the assignment, and; maintain the confidentiality of client proprietary, confidential, or non-public information. In addition, job duties require access to secure and protected client information technology systems and related data security obligations.